How much does it cost to rent a home in Laurel?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Laurel 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,530 | $895 | $2,200 |
Laurel 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,841 | $1,495 | $2,400 |
Laurel 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,030 | $1,695 | $2,400 |
Laurel 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,700 | $2,700 | $2,700 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Laurel
What type of rentals are currently available in Laurel?
There are currently 54 Apartments for Rent in Laurel, DE with pricing that ranges from $377 to $4,330. There are also 36 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Laurel ranging from $895 to $2,700.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Laurel?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Laurel ranges from $895 to $2,700 with an average monthly rent of $2,025.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Laurel?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Laurel range from $527 to $3,750,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,495 to $2,400.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,695 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$950.
